When to prune azaleasThe pruning time of azalea is determined according to its growth zone. It needs to be pruned when it starts to grow luxuriantly, after the flowering period, and during the period of disease and insect pests. If the pruned branches of azalea are to be used for cuttings, the leaves at the base should be cut off, leaving about 4 leaves, and then the cuttings should be planted in the soil. Pay attention to watering thoroughly to keep them moist. How to prune the branches of azaleaThe main purpose of azalea pruning is to cut off some thin branches, overgrown branches, thin branches, diseased branches and dead branches, among which the main ones to be pruned are overgrown branches and deformed branches. Leggy branches : Leggy branches refer to those branches that grow too prominently and in a disorderly length. After the plant flowers, you can use thinning pruning to remove the leggy branches. This not only allows other branches to receive light more evenly, but also controls and improves the shape of the plant. Deformed branches : Deformed branches are those branches that look messy and seriously affect the beauty of the plant. They need to be pruned immediately to avoid affecting the healthy growth of other branches and leaves, maintaining the beautiful appearance of the potted plants and improving their ornamental value. Azalea pruning tipsIf the branches of azalea are too long, they should be cut back to 1/3 to 2/3 of the length. It should not be too long or too short, as that will affect its appearance. When cutting off branches or leaves that are infected with pests and diseases, be sure to cut close to the base and do not leave even a little bit of disease to avoid recurrence of the old damage in the future. When pruning the azalea potted plants, think of a general shape in your mind to avoid pruning plants of different lengths, which will affect the appearance. Azalea grows fast after pruningIf you want azalea to grow faster, you need to trim off the withered flowers after they fade. This can reduce excessive consumption of nutrients and promote the growth of plant branches. Azalea pruning and floweringIn order for azalea to grow and bloom, the plants need to be pinched and topped in time, and the dead branches and leaves need to be trimmed frequently, which can promote the flowering of azalea. Notes on pruning azaleaWhen pruning azaleas, in addition to pruning diseased, insect-infested, weak branches and overgrown branches, in order to promote the next round of flowering, it is also necessary to promptly prune away the withered flowers and prune those branches that have flowered but are not growing properly. Due to the high temperature in summer, the plants basically enter a dormant period and stop growing, so it is not advisable to prune them. In order to keep the plants alive, they need to be placed in a cool and ventilated place for maintenance. |
